Transaction 28e029126e35c4e9daa5820cf165dc70d9c37aaa9f8c7eaed8106308a16b4a26
1 Input
1 Output
-
28e029126e35c4e9daa5820cf165dc70d9c37aaa9f8c7eaed8106308a16b4a26:0
- value
- 596392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22ec910873c1a247a6613f1931d1c5bbf7032097 OP_EQUAL
- address
- 34sgHznD35ZKg1wKWNgbFkkk7VRBhRset9